  3. 23 Απρ 2012 · On Mac, you can delete the iOS firmware by going to Finder, pressing ⌘ cmd + ⇧ shift + G and go to ~/Library/iTunes/iPhone Software Updates. From there, you can delete the files. You don't have to delete them unless you are short on disk space, as they get replaced by newly downloaded files whenever there is an upgrade.

  4. 29 Μαρ 2019 · Please press Windows key + R simultaneously and type in %appdata% followed by the ENTER key. This should lead you to your AppData\Roaming folder. You should find .ispw files located following "Apple Computer\iTunes\iPhone Software Updates" which are indeed updates for your iPhone.
